比特币是首次成功实现去中心化支付的加密货币系统,其底层技术是区块链。作为一种数字资产,比特币的流通需要一种安全稳定的存储方式,这就需要用到比特币钱包。
比特币钱包可以视为一个虚拟的账户,它存储着用户的比特币私钥和公钥,进而生成比特币地址。可以将其理解为一个邮箱地址,任何人都可以向这个地址发送比特币,但是只有拥有相应私钥的人才能支配这个钱包中的比特币。
比特币地址是由一串数字和字母组成,作用是标识一个唯一的账户,用户可以通过该地址接收和发送比特币。
#### 2. 比特币地址的构成比特币地址通常有几种不同的类型,每种类型的构成方式也有所区别。最常见的包括P2PKH(Pay to Public Key Hash)地址,以数字1开头,长度一般为34个字符,P2SH(Pay to Script Hash)地址以数字3开头。同时,新兴的SegWit地址则以bc1开头,这些类型的地址在构成上有不同的规则和特征。
比特币地址的长度也受到加密算法的影响,通常最短的比特币地址为26个字符,最长可超过42个字符。每一个地址都有一个“校验和”功能用于防止错误输入,从而提高地址的准确性。
#### 3. 最小比特币地址的定义在比特币网络中,“最小地址”并不指一个具体的地址,而是指地址的可用性。也就是说,尽管比特币地址的长度各不相同,但每一个有效地址都需要遵循一定的编码规范。因此,最小有效比特币地址是一个需要满足网络要求的地址,例如它的有效性和可用性。
实际上,比特币地址不仅仅依赖其长度来定义,也与相关的网络规则和协议紧密相连。用户在生成地址时需要遵循这些标准。
#### 4. 比特币地址的生成和管理要创建一个比特币地址,用户需要借助比特币钱包软件。用户可以选择全节点钱包、轻钱包或在线钱包等不同的工具,每种工具的生成方式和安全性都有所不同。
在生成地址的过程中,用户首先需要创建一个公钥和私钥对,私钥是维持钱包安全的关键,其应被严格保密,公钥则用于生成比特币地址。
管理比特币地址时,用户应该定期备份钱包,确保私钥的安全存储,还要注意监测钱包地址是否有异常活动。
#### 5. 比特币地址的安全性比特币地址的安全性主要取决于用户如何管理其私钥。若私钥丢失或被窃取,用户就会失去对钱包中比特币的控制权,甚至可能导致资产的全部损失。
此外,网络钓鱼、恶意软件等也是用户需要警惕的安全威胁。因此,建议用户采用冷钱包、两步验证、强密码等安全措施,充分保护自己的比特币资产。
#### 6. 比特币地址与交易的关系比特币地址在交易中扮演着核心角色,无论是发送或者接收比特币,都需要指定特定的地址。用户在发起交易时会用到钱包中生成的地址,并通过网络广播该交易。
用户也可以通过区块链浏览器,根据接收地址查询相关的交易记录。这种公开透明的特性使得比特币交易具有良好的可追溯性,但同时也带来了隐私保护的挑战。
### 相关问题 1. **比特币地址的类型有什么区别?** 2. **如何安全地存储比特币钱包的私钥?** 3. **比特币地址的校验和是如何生成的?** 4. **比特币交易延迟的原因是什么?** 5. **为什么比特币地址的长度不同?** 6. **如何从比特币地址中查找对应的交易信息?** ### 各相关问题的详细介绍 #### 1. 比特币地址的类型有什么区别?比特币使用不同的地址类型来适应不同的支付方式和钱包功能。最常见的地址类型包括P2PKH(以1开头)、P2SH(以3开头)和Bech32(以bc1开头)。
P2PKH是比特币最基本的地址类型,通常用于简单的比特币转帐。这种地址虽然使用广泛,但在确认时间上会有所延迟。P2SH地址则支持多重签名验证,适合需要额外安全性的场合,因为它要求多个私钥来完成交易。
Bech32地址则是较新的地址类型,主要兼容SegWit技术。相较于传统地址,Bech32地址的交易费用较低,处理速度更快,并且对低级别的错误检测也有帮助。
这些地址类型在功能和特性上各有差异,用户在使用时应了解其适用场景,以选择最合适的地址类型。
#### 2. 如何安全地存储比特币钱包的私钥?私钥是控制比特币的唯一凭证,因此安全存储私钥至关重要。首先,用户可以选择使用冷钱包,例如硬件钱包或纸钱包,这样私钥就不会连接网络,从而减少黑客攻击的风险。
其次,用户可以将私钥加密存储在本地计算机,但是要确保使用强密码并采用最新的安全软件进行保护。同时,定期备份非常重要,将备份保留在多个安全地点可以极大减少意外丢失的风险。
此外,避免在不安全的设备上进入私钥信息,定期更换密码,并开启多重身份验证,是确保私钥安全的有效方式。
#### 3. 比特币地址的校验和是如何生成的?比特币地址的校验和是用于验证地址有效性的机制。地址在生成时,通常会先生成公钥的哈希值,然后经过一定的算法(一种如SHA-256和RIPEMD-160的组合)进行处理,确保输入的地址没有错误。
校验和的生成过程通常包括以下步骤:
通过这种方式,可以有效避免因输入错误导致的损失,校验和使得用户在进行交易或接收比特币时能够更加放心。
#### 4. 比特币交易延迟的原因是什么?在比特币网络中,合理的交易处理时间通常是在10分钟左右,但有时候交易会出现延迟现象。导致交易延迟的原因有很多,其中最主要的都来自网络和区块链的特性。
首先,区块链的交易处理速度受到每个区块大小的限制,每个区块最多能容纳约1MB的数据。这意味着在高峰期,历史遗留的交易会造成网络拥堵,导致新交易的确认时间延长。
其次,交易费的设置也影响到交易的优先级。如果用户设置了较低的交易费用,矿工可能会选择优先处理费用高的交易,导致更低费用的交易处理时间变长。
此外,网络节点的同步和质量也会对交易产生影响。如果用户连接的节点在网络中不够可靠,交易的传播速度就会受到限制,形成延迟。
#### 5. 为什么比特币地址的长度不同?比特币地址的长度不同,主要是由于不同类型的地址采取了不同的编码方案。比如,传统的P2PKH地址通常为34个字符,而P2SH地址为34个字符,即使在格式上存在一些相似之处。
最新的Bech32地址则采用了一种新的编码方式,使得字符更为简洁,通常由42个字符组成。与传统编码方式相比,Bech32地址允许更高效的数据处理,特别是在处理SegWit交易时,大幅提高了交易的速度和安全性。
不同长度和类型的地址保证了比特币网络的多样化需求,以适应不断发展的加密货币市场,同时也区别了用户在交易选择时的差异化。
#### 6. 如何从比特币地址中查找对应的交易信息?要从比特币地址中查找通信交易信息,用户可以使用区块链浏览器,这是一种允许用户查询特定地址的交易记录和相关信息的在线工具。许多区块链浏览器提供了用户友好的界面,便于用户输入地址并查看交易历史。
在输入某个比特币地址后,查询结果通常会显示该地址的所有交易记录,包括交易哈希、时间戳、状态(如确认数)等信息。这些数据都是公开的,提供透明度并使用户能够跟踪资金流向。
通过区块链浏览器,用户还可以查看未来的交易和未确认的交易,这样可以更好地管理成本和时间。因此,熟悉如何使用区块链浏览器对于比特币用户来说是至关重要的。
### 结语 以上通过对比特币钱包地址的最小范围、类型、生成、安全性、交易关系等相关细节的阐述,帮助用户深入了解比特币的基本操作和相关知识。而通过解答人们对于比特币地址的疑问,更加促进了对这一新兴金融工具的认识,推动其普及与使用。在这个飞速发展的加密货币世界中,用户只有充分了解这其中的关键概念,才能更好地保障资产的安全性以及提高交易的效率。
leave a reply